BEIRUT: A rebel bastion in the Idlib region of northwest Syria has recorded its first death from the novel coronavirus, a health official said Friday. The jihadist-dominated stronghold is home to some three million people, many living in close quarters in displacement camps after being forced to flee their homes during Syria's nine-year-old war.
Emad Zahran, spokesperson for the health directorate in rebel-held areas of Idlib province, said the death of an 80-year-old displaced woman living in a camp in the town of Sarmada was recorded on Tuesday. "She suffered from severe renal insufficiency and high blood pressure," he said.
